✅ The Complete RV Setup Checklist

Step 1: Initial Positioning and Safety
Before You Unhook:
☐ Survey your campsite completely
- Check for low branches or obstacles
- Identify utility connections
- Look for level ground
- Ensure adequate slide clearance
☐ Position your RV strategically
- Align for easiest hookup access
- Consider sun exposure and shade
- Think about your view and privacy
- Leave room for awning deployment
☐ Secure your RV
- Engage parking brake
- Put transmission in park (or gear for manual)
- Turn off engine
- Place wheel chocks on both sides of tires
Step 2: Leveling Your RV (The Foundation of Comfort)
Proper leveling is crucial for:
- Refrigerator operation
- Comfortable sleeping
- Proper drainage
- Door and drawer function
Side-to-Side Leveling (Do This First!):
☐ Check level with bubble level or app ☐ Identify which side needs raising ☐ Place leveling blocks on low side ☐ Drive onto blocks (don’t unhook first!) ☐ Recheck level and adjust if needed
Front-to-Back Leveling:
☐ Unhook from tow vehicle (after side leveling) ☐ Use tongue jack or landing gear ☐ Level using built-in or separate level ☐ Lower stabilizer jacks (for stability only) ☐ Never use stabilizers to level

Step 3: Utility Hookups (Your Lifelines to Comfort)
Electrical Connection (Always First!):
☐ Turn OFF all breakers at pedestal ☐ Inspect pedestal for damage or burns ☐ Plug in surge protector/EMS device ☐ Connect RV power cord to surge protector ☐ Turn breakers ON one at a time ☐ Verify power at RV panel
Safety Note: Never skip surge protection. One bad pedestal can destroy your RV’s entire electrical system.
Water Connection:
☐ Run water at spigot briefly (flush debris) ☐ Attach pressure regulator to spigot ☐ Connect water filter (if using) ☐ Attach fresh water hose ☐ Connect to RV city water inlet ☐ Turn on water slowly ☐ Check for leaks at all connections
Sewer Connection:
☐ Put on disposable gloves ☐ Remove sewer cap from RV ☐ Connect sewer hose with secure fittings ☐ Place hose support if needed ☐ Insert other end into dump connection ☐ Create proper slope for drainage ☐ Keep valves closed until dumping
Cable/Internet (If Available):
☐ Connect coax cable for TV ☐ Set up WiFi booster if needed ☐ Position cellular booster antenna
Step 4: Interior Setup for Comfort
Systems Activation:
☐ Extend slides (check clearance again!) ☐ Turn on water pump (if not on city water) ☐ Switch refrigerator to electric mode ☐ Fill water heater before turning on ☐ Wait 10 minutes, then activate water heater ☐ Open propane valves if needed ☐ Test stove burners briefly
Climate Control:
☐ Open roof vents for ventilation ☐ Deploy vent covers if rain expected ☐ Start A/C or furnace as needed ☐ Open windows for cross-breeze ☐ Adjust thermostats to comfort level
Living Space Setup:
☐ Extend awning (check weather first) ☐ Set up outdoor furniture ☐ Deploy outdoor mat/rug ☐ Hang outdoor lights ☐ Set up grill or outdoor kitchen
Step 5: Final Safety Checks
Before You Relax:
☐ Test all GFCI outlets ☐ Check smoke and CO detectors ☐ Verify all slides locked in position ☐ Ensure steps are stable ☐ Test interior lights ☐ Confirm hot water is working ☐ Check that doors open/close properly
